California Gov. Gavin Newsom has signed a bill allowing 800,000 Uber and Lyft drivers in the state to join a union and bargain collectively for better wages and benefits.
Probably forces Uber and Lyft to a negotiation table where they can bargain for better rates, and allows contractors to organize as if they were employees, including the ability to strike.
